Simplifying x + 4(2x + -3) = 5 + -7x Reorder the terms: x + 4(-3 + 2x) = 5 + -7x x + (-3 * 4 + 2x * 4) = 5 + -7x x + (-12 + 8x) = 5 + -7x Reorder the terms: -12 + x + 8x = 5 + -7x Combine like terms: x + 8x = 9x -12 + 9x = 5 + -7x Solving -12 + 9x = 5 + -7x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'7x' to each side of the equation. -12 + 9x + 7x = 5 + -7x + 7x Combine like terms: 9x + 7x = 16x -12 + 16x = 5 + -7x + 7x Combine like terms: -7x + 7x = 0 -12 + 16x = 5 + 0 -12 + 16x = 5 Add '12' to each side of the equation. -12 + 12 + 16x = 5 + 12 Combine like terms: -12 + 12 = 0 0 + 16x = 5 + 12 16x = 5 + 12 Combine like terms: 5 + 12 = 17 16x = 17 Divide each side by '16'. x = 1.0625 Simplifying x = 1.0625
